Coder Social home page Coder Social logo

highoncarbs / hafta Goto Github PK

View Code? Open in Web Editor NEW
119.0 4.0 36.0 6.09 MB

๐Ÿ’ธ Settle payrolls faster with Hafta.

Home Page: https://highoncarbs.github.io/Hafta/

License: MIT License

Python 12.65% CSS 0.42% HTML 30.48% JavaScript 56.41% Mako 0.04%
payroll hr vue hrm payroll-management-system payroll-processing attendance attendance-system attendance-management business

hafta's Introduction

New version under active development , checkout alpha branch.




Dead Simple way to manage Payrolls and performance of your employees
Built with Indian businesses , for Indian businesses


Built to help ease payrolls for Manufactoring segment of Indian Businesses specifically. Feel free to make changes to your needs .

Features

  • Manage your employees , handle their advances , attendence and payroll with ease.
  • HR tools to check performance of employees, add quick incident reports.
  • Add basic data with Masters , allows for quick and easy customization.
  • Check and allow advances to your employees .Set limits to number of times and amount allowed for each employee.

Setup & Running

NOTE: You'll need to use python3.

To install requirements :

pip install -r requirements.txt

Hafta uses MySQL as a backend , but you are free to use any. Just change the the Database URI in config.py

python ./run.py

Issues and Requests

For any issue or requests , please use Github Issues.

Projects Used

  • Bulma
  • Vue.js
  • SQLAlchemy
  • Buefy
  • Flask
  • Albemic

License

This project is licensed under the MIT License.

hafta's People

Contributors

highoncarbs avatar imgbotapp avatar

Stargazers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

Watchers

 avatar  avatar  avatar  avatar

hafta's Issues

Conflict Versions

Conflict in the versions of lazy object proxy astroid, need to update the version in requirements.txt

Hardcoded secret key

Hello Hafta developers,

We are a cybersecurity research group from the CISPA Helmholtz Center for Information Security and Caโ€™ Foscari University of Venice. We recently conducted an analysis of the session management used in your web application as part of our research. We have discovered a security vulnerability that we believe requires your attention.

Vulnerability Description:

After our analysis, we have identified that your application is using a hard-coded secret key that is leaked through GitHub. If operators who install your web application do not change this secret key, they are vulnerable to cookie forgeries. The cookie forgery attack allows an attacker, knowing the key used to sign a cookie, to forge new arbitrary cookies to impersonate and take over other accounts.

SECRET_KEY = 'you-will-never-guess'

Recommendation for Mitigation:

To address this vulnerability and enhance the security posture of your web application, we highly recommend setting the secret key from an environment variable. If the environment file is not shared on GitHub then this would force operators of your application to create their own key upon installation, forcing them to set their own secure secret key.

We hope this notification helps improve your security. Should you have further questions or comments on this feel free to answer this thread or reach out to [email protected].

Kind regards,
Florian Hantke

Get a license key not working.

I have installed this application successfully but when I tried to register one user it's showing me I need to have a license key. When I press to get a license key it's redirecting me the registration page.

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.